Material is removed by milling, grinding, grooving, scribing, hammering, sandblasting or flame blasting. With the exception of sandblasting, all of these processes involve a relatively large loss of substance for the top layer and a correspondingly high level of effort. As has been shown by surprising observations and by subsequent investigations, the grip can, however, be improved in the long term by the mechanical action of a smooth-wheel roller if its surface pressure is increased accordingly by reducing the contact area. Structural disturbances arise in the protruding ceiling components, which are sufficient for a substantial improvement in grip without a significant loss of substance occurring. Apparently, the partial area treated in this way remains almost unchanged. However, the microstructure, which is decisive for the grip with (usually sufficient surface roughness), has changed significantly. Smooth rollers are not suitable for targeted improvements in grip, because the conventional bandages only touch the surfaces of old roads in partial areas and do not provide sufficient pressure when they are in full contact.
